The influence of the characteristics of Chinese traditional culture on Chinese culture

The characteristics of Chinese traditional culture, including ideology, morality, art, philosophy, etiquette, etc., had a profound impact on Chinese culture. In terms of ideology, traditional Chinese culture emphasized the five virtues of "benevolence, righteousness, propriety, wisdom, and faith". It had always believed that people should pursue moral excellence based on these five virtues. This thought influenced the values and moral standards of Chinese culture, which made Chinese culture emphasize interpersonal relationships, family, friends and social responsibility. In terms of morality, traditional Chinese culture emphasized the moral norms of loyalty, filial piety, fraternity, faith, propriety, and righteousness. It believed that people should abide by these norms and be morally noble. This thought influenced the behavior and interpersonal relationships of Chinese culture, which made Chinese culture pay attention to moral cultivation and self-restraint. In terms of art, traditional Chinese culture included painting, music, dance, drama, poetry, and many other art forms that emphasized the artistic concept of "harmony, balance, nature, and humanity." This thought influenced the aesthetic standards and artistic creation of Chinese culture, making Chinese culture pay attention to the harmony and balance of art, emphasizing the harmony between man and nature. In terms of philosophy, traditional Chinese culture emphasized the philosophy of "harmony between man and nature, and the Tao follows nature." It believed that people should live in harmony with the natural environment and pursue harmony between man and nature. This thought influenced the philosophy and practice of Chinese culture, making Chinese culture pay attention to environmental protection and sustainable development. In terms of etiquette, traditional Chinese culture emphasized the concept of "order of seniority, modesty and prudence" and believed that people should pay attention to etiquette and respect their elders and others. This thought influenced the social etiquette and interpersonal communication in Chinese culture, making Chinese culture pay attention to the harmonious development of interpersonal relationships.

The influence of ancient Chinese farming culture on Chinese traditional culture

The farming culture of ancient China had a profound influence on the traditional Chinese culture. The development of ancient Chinese farming civilization not only provided enough food and other agricultural products for Chinese society, but also promoted social, economic, political and cultural progress. What was the difference between Chinese traditional culture and Western traditional culture?

There were many differences between Chinese traditional culture and Western traditional culture. 1. Value: Chinese traditional culture emphasized values such as harmony, benevolence, etiquette, loyalty and filial piety, while Western traditional culture emphasized values such as freedom, equality, rights, rationality, etc. 2.
